Meaning & usage

noun
  1. Any protein (especially ones produced by viruses) that cleave to produce a number of polypeptides, some of which act as hormones

Where this word comes from

Etymology tree Proto-Indo-European *pleh₁-der. Proto-Indo-European *polh₁ús Ancient Greek πολῠ́ς (polŭ́s)lbor. English poly- English protein English polyprotein From poly- + protein.
